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91250134669 940 817360287 48801 69050481
3083374576 64911 8226330501
3083374576 64911 8226330501
64 680051450 0700
All about undefined
Interested in learning more?
3083374576 64911 8226330501
64 680051450 0700
See more
4684751538 53334
597926 26110013 4934853983 9211 86738711312
See more
050738 942697
22 7389 926391
See more